Assembler/Sequencer 2nd Shift - Full Time
About the role
Assembler or Sequencer position will be responsible for operating production line equipment, finishing products, and reporting any issues with equipment or station directly to a direct supervisor. This opportunity provides hands-on, day-to-day technical interaction within automotive manufacturing. The role can include repetitive lifting, twisting, and bending in a factory setting.
Responsibilities
- Assemble goods on production lines following applicable work instructions
- Carry out basic quality and testing checks
- Follow Company’s philosophies and values at all times
- Maintain a safe work environment through good housekeeping in work areas and equipment
- Adhere to safe work practices at all times
- Monitor the production process and assist the team in achieving production goals
- Ensure all production and quality systems are followed at all times; maintain required jobs per hour
- Communicate information to allow the team to make appropriate decisions and focus on necessary improvements
- Help the team meet customer expectations
- Feed raw materials into production machinery such as torque guns, hoists, electric drills, industrial hot glue guns, and electric screwdrivers when needed
- Lift and/or move up to 40 pounds consistently (over 7.25 hours per day, 5-6 days per week)
- Store goods and raw materials properly in the warehouse
- Use lifting equipment to fulfill orders
- Pack goods to be shipped
- Participate in job rotation every 2 to 2.5 hours to minimize muscle stress/overuse
- All other duties as assigned
